The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words

You might notice changes in your body as you age. Your recovery feels slower, and maintaining muscle mass becomes harder. This growth hormone releasing peptide protocol offers a unique approach to these challenges.

The therapy involves a specific peptide known as sermorelin acetate. This compound acts as a GHRH analog, meaning it mimics a natural hormone your body already produces. It gently encourages your pituitary gland to release more of your own grow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ile manner. This differs significantly from direct growth hormone replacement.

By stimulating your body’s own systems, this compounded prescription aims to support overall wellness. It helps restore levels of IGF-1, a critical marker often declining with age. You might experience benefits related to improved body composition, better sleep quality, and enhanced recovery from physical exertion. Remember, a licensed clinician must determine your medical necessity for this protocol.

Frequently Asked Questions About This Peptide Therapy

Is this like HGH

No, this peptide therapy is distinct from synthetic human growth hormone (HGH). You are not introducing exogenous HGH into your body. Instead, the protocol stimulates your own pituitary gland to naturally produce and release more of your body’s growth hormone. This mechanism encourages a more physiological and regulated response, which avoids some of the potential downsides associated with direct HGH administration.

How do I administer the protocol

You administer this therapy through simple subcutaneous injections, typically once daily before bedtime. The needles are very fine, similar to those used by diabetics, making the process generally painless. Your telehealth provider offers comprehensive training and resources. They will guide you through the proper injection technique, ensuring you feel comfortable and confident managing your protocol at home.

What patients typically report

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.

Adult relaxing at home checking telehealth treatment progress on a smartphone
  1. Weeks 1 to 4

    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.

  2. Weeks 5 to 8

    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.

  3. Weeks 9 to 12

    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.

  4. Month 4 and beyond

    A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.
